How Nonprofits Can Track Google Grant Conversions in Google Analytics

Nonprofit Tech for Good

Any time you see an impressive Google Grant case study , the metrics are always made possible through conversion tracking. . Both organizations are using the Maximize Conversions bid strategy, which Google requires. The Google Grant gives nonprofits $10,000/month to spend on ads in Google Search.

What is a good social media strategy for nonprofits? Your organization’s social media strategy should be a carefully structured plan with SMART goals, posting frequency, key dates (like an awareness month tied to your mission), and content guidelines for posts.
